Americas Best Value Inn & Suites Winona

Americas Best Value Inn & Suites Winona Address: 301 SE Frontage Road, Winona, United States

Minimum price found for Americas Best Value Inn & Suites Winona was: Null USD

Click here to get more information, photos & guest ratings for Americas Best Value Inn & Suites Winona